Intro to Robotic Hoover and Mop Systems
Robotic hoover and mop systems are autonomous cleaning devices created to maintain the cleanliness of homes and offices. These gadgets use innovative robotics, artificial intelligence (AI), and sensor technology to browse and tidy floorings, carpets, and difficult surfaces. Unlike traditional vacuum and mops, robotic systems can operate independently, scheduling cleaning jobs and adjusting their habits based on the environment and user preferences.
Secret Features of Robotic Hoover and Mop Systems
Autonomous Navigation
- Laser Mapping: Many high-end models use laser navigation to create an in-depth map of the home environment. This permits the robot to prepare its cleaning path effectively and avoid barriers.
- Vision Sensors: Some models are equipped with video cameras and vision sensing units to find and navigate around barriers, guaranteeing that they do not get stuck or damage furnishings.
- Edge Detection: To prevent falls, these robotics utilize edge detection sensing units that stop them from cleaning near stairs or other drop-offs.
Cleaning Capabilities
- HEPA Filters: High-efficiency particle air (HEPA) filters catch great dust and irritants, making these gadgets suitable for homes with family pets or allergic reaction victims.
- Several Cleaning Modes: Most robotic hoovers and mops offer different cleaning modes, such as spot cleaning, edge cleaning, and deep cleaning, to attend to various cleaning requirements.
- Mop and Vacuum Combination: Some designs integrate vacuuming and mopping in one gadget, conserving effort and time by carrying out both jobs simultaneously.
Smart Technology Integration
-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it permits users to manage the robot with voice commands.
- App Control: Users can set up cleaning, keep an eye on the robot's status, and get notifications through dedicated mobile apps.
- Automated Charging: When the battery is low, the robot go back to its charging dock automatically, guaranteeing it is always all set for the next cleaning session.
User-Friendly Design
- Compact Size: Robotic hoovers and mops are developed to fit under furniture and in tight spaces, making them ideal for small homes or chaotic spaces.
- Low Noise: Many models are developed to run silently, reducing interruption to day-to-day activities.
- Eco-Friendly: Some robotics are energy-efficient and usage water and cleaning services moderately, making them an environmentally mindful choice.

How Robotic Hoover and Mop Systems Work
Mapping and Navigation
- Initial Mapping: Upon setup, the robot creates a map of the home utilizing its sensing units. This map is then stored in its memory for future recommendation.
- Path Planning: Using the map, the robot plans its cleaning route, ensuring it covers all locations effectively.
- Obstacle Avoidance: Advanced sensing units and algorithms assist the robot identify and avoid challenges, preventing damage to furniture and itself.
Cleaning Process
- Vacuuming: The robot utilizes a mix of brushes and suction to remove dust, dirt, and particles from floors and carpets.
- Mopping: For hard surface areas, the robot dispenses water and cleaning solution, then utilizes a microfiber pad to mop the floor.
- Self-Cleaning: Some designs feature self-cleaning brushes and filters, decreasing the requirement for manual upkeep.
Upkeep and Care
- Filter Cleaning: Regular cleaning of the HEPA filter is necessary to preserve the robot's performance.
- Water Reservoir: For mopping designs, the water reservoir requires to be filled up and emptied as required.
- Software Updates: Keeping the robot's software application as much as date guarantees it operates at its best and can gain from new functions and improvements.

Frequently Asked Questions (FAQs)
Q: Are robotic hoovers and mops ideal for pet owners?
- A: Yes, numerous models are specifically developed with family pets in mind. They feature effective suction, HEPA filters to record pet hair and allergens, and resilient brushes that can manage pet messes.
Q: Can these robots clean stairs?
- A: Most robotic hoovers and mops are not created to clean stairs due to the threat of damage. However, some designs have edge detection sensing units that prevent them from falling off stairs.
Q: How frequently do I need to clean up the robot's filter and brushes?
- A: It is advised to clean up the filter and brushes after each usage, specifically if there is a great deal of pet hair or debris. This ensures ideal performance and durability of the device.
Q: Can I manage the robot from my smartphone?
- A: Yes, many designs include devoted mobile apps that allow users to control the robot, schedule cleaning sessions, and monitor its status from anywhere.
Q: How do I set up a robotic hoover or mop?
- A: Setup usually includes charging the robot, downloading the mobile app, and producing a map of the home environment. robovacuum require Wi-Fi connection for advanced features.
Q: Are these robotics eco-friendly?
- A: Many models are developed to be energy-efficient and use water and cleaning services moderately, making them an environmentally friendly option for home cleaning.
